The License Problem No One Talks About

Start at the very foundation: Royal Planet Casino has no visible license. None. Zip. The site doesn’t display a regulator’s seal, and the FAQ says US players are restricted-except the terms only mention the Virgin Islands. So which is it? Contradictions like that aren’t accidental. They’re a red flag the size of a planet. Without a license, there’s no authority to appeal to if things go wrong. You’re playing on trust alone, and trust is a fragile thing in online gambling.

Bonuses: Read the Fine Print or Lose

Bonuses here are a minefield. The welcome offers look generous, but watch out for the two-tier structure: a free chip and a free play bonus. That “free play” requires a deposit before you can cash out any winnings. And the wagering requirements? Brutal. Free offers demand near-impossible playthroughs. The no-deposit bonus has a max cashout that can turn a $4,000 win into a $70 payout-as one player learned the hard way. Here’s what you need to know before claiming anything:

  1. Always check if a no-deposit bonus has a winnings cap.
  2. Card games contribute zero to wagering requirements-slots are your only real bet.
  3. Some deposit bonuses come with a hidden limit on how much you can actually win.

What Players Actually Say (Spoiler: It’s Not Pretty)

Scrolling through player feedback is like watching a slow-motion car crash. The same complaints surface again and again: withdrawal delays measured in months, chat agents giving contradictory answers, documents “lost” after being confirmed received. One user detailed a back-and-forth that stretched over 40 days, exactly the point where the terms allow the casino to confiscate unclaimed funds. Another player reported being blocked from their account right after hitting a $300 win, with no warning. Here’s the pattern:

  • Payouts routinely take 5-6 business days just to process, then another week or more.
  • Customer support is friendly but powerless-or outright dishonest.
  • Bitcoin withdrawals work for some, but bank transfers and e-wallets are notoriously slow.
